About this property
The property proudly showcases its industrial heritage with exposed brickwork, original Crittall windows, steel beams, and solid wooden floors, all of which lend a tangible sense of warmth and character.
Upon entering, you are greeted by a spacious hallway featuring extensive floor-to-ceiling, deep built-in storage running the length of the corridor. The hallway leads to a large bathroom suite, complete with an expansive shower and a separate bathtub.
The generously sized, east-facing bedroom benefits from morning light and includes a floor-to-ceiling built-in wardrobe. It opens directly onto a private balcony the perfect spot for a morning coffee or evening relaxation.
The highlight of this remarkable home is the expansive open-plan kitchen, living, and dining area ideal for everyday living, working, and entertaining. This space boasts impressive triple-aspect views through five large arched windows, a second balcony overlooking the canal, a double loading bay, and a New York loft-style fire escape with a substantial landing.
Natural light floods the interior from the southwest, west, and north, illuminating the apartment throughout the best part of the day. The property enjoys exceptional privacy, due to the distance of neighbouring buildings.
Set within the highly sought-after Spratt’s warehouse conversion, the apartment further benefits from two dedicated parking spaces: one very large secure underground space and an additional covered space with extra secure storage adding both convenience and practicality.
Uniquely, the property offers significant reconfiguration potential. The vendors advise that it holds two separate leases and features two entrance doors, creating a rare opportunity to reconfigure the layout or even create two self-contained apartments (subject to necessary consents)
Local information
- Colmans Wharf, part of the Spratt’s Factory Complex, is ideally located along the scenic Limehouse Cut Canal, making it highly attractive to commuters traveling to the City, or Canary Wharf, with easy access to Shoreditch, Borough, Farringdon and Greenwich night life.
- Colmans Wharf is within easy walking distance (approximately 7 minutes) of two DLR stations Langdon Park and Devons Road providing direct links to Canary Wharf, Greenwich, Bank/Tower Hill, and Stratford, with extensive London Underground network (Jubilee, Elizabeth, and Central lines) as well as Overground rail across South East and East of England.
- Nearby, there are plenty of green spaces for dog lovers, Barlett Park being the closest (5 mins away) including the prodigious Olympic Park and expansive Greenwich Park, as well as an array of gyms, sports centres, canal-sidewalks, kayaking, tennis clubs, and cycling routes. The area also offers an enviable selection of bars, cafés, and cinemas whether you head towards Limehouse Basin or the Thames riverfront or the up and coming fashionable Grand Union Canal.
